Overview

UhpT is a bacterial hexose-6-phosphate:phosphate antiporter belonging to the Major Facilitator Superfamily (MFS). It functions as a membrane-bound transporter that facilitates the uptake of hexose phosphates, such as glucose-6-phosphate, from the extracellular environment or host cytoplasm into the bacterial cell in exchange for internal inorganic phosphate. This transport system is vital for the metabolic adaptation and virulence of pathogens like Staphylococcus aureus and Escherichia coli, enabling them to exploit host-derived nutrients during infection. UhpT is clinically significant as the primary portal for the entry of the antibiotic fosfomycin, which acts as a structural mimic of glucose-6-phosphate. Once inside the cell, fosfomycin inhibits the enzyme MurA, disrupting cell wall synthesis and leading to bacterial death. Resistance to fosfomycin frequently arises through mutations or deletions in the uhpT gene or its regulatory components (UhpABC), which reduce drug accumulation within the bacterium. Consequently, UhpT is a key focus in understanding antibiotic susceptibility and developing strategies to overcome drug resistance in bacterial pathogens.
